Output d2eca2964a2e95d6aea4c67cf9bde4cfd892c1f34bf61efa8e67d38ef27e3ddb:7

value
466195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93478d44da511ccc3adf7b03a6244bf959645d81 OP_EQUAL
address
3F7kyFXVQo3o51wLbRPu44ss6w56QHxjDg
transaction
d2eca2964a2e95d6aea4c67cf9bde4cfd892c1f34bf61efa8e67d38ef27e3ddb
confirmations
388367
spent
true